"""Shared helpers for resolving replay checkpoints on one checkpoint lineage.""" from __future__ import annotations from collections.abc import Sequence from typing import Any class CheckpointLineageError(RuntimeError): """Raised when a requested checkpoint ancestor cannot be resolved safely.""" class CheckpointParentMissingError(CheckpointLineageError): """Raised when a legacy checkpoint does not record its parent link.""" class CheckpointLineageIntegrityError(CheckpointLineageError): """Raised when recorded checkpoint lineage is present but unsafe to use.""" def checkpoint_messages(checkpoint_tuple: Any) -> list[Any]: values = getattr(checkpoint_tuple, "values", None) if isinstance(values, dict): messages = values.get("messages", []) return list(messages) if isinstance(messages, list) else [] checkpoint = getattr(checkpoint_tuple, "checkpoint", None) or {} channel_values = checkpoint.get("channel_values", {}) if isinstance(checkpoint, dict) else {} messages = channel_values.get("messages", []) if isinstance(channel_values, dict) else [] return list(messages) if isinstance(messages, list) else [] def checkpoint_configurable(checkpoint_tuple: Any) -> dict[str, Any]: config = getattr(checkpoint_tuple, "config", None) or {} configurable = config.get("configurable", {}) if isinstance(config, dict) else {} return dict(configurable) if isinstance(configurable, dict) else {} def checkpoint_metadata(checkpoint_tuple: Any) -> dict[str, Any]: metadata = getattr(checkpoint_tuple, "metadata", None) or {} return dict(metadata) if isinstance(metadata, dict) else {} def is_duration_only_checkpoint(checkpoint_tuple: Any) -> bool: writes = checkpoint_metadata(checkpoint_tuple).get("writes") return isinstance(writes, dict) and "runtime_run_duration" in writes def _message_id(message: Any) -> str | None: value = getattr(message, "id", None) if value is None and isinstance(message, dict): value = message.get("id") return str(value) if value else None def _config_identity(config: dict[str, Any]) -> tuple[str, str, str] | None: configurable = config.get("configurable", {}) thread_id = configurable.get("thread_id") checkpoint_ns = configurable.get("checkpoint_ns", "") checkpoint_id = configurable.get("checkpoint_id") if not isinstance(thread_id, str) or not thread_id or not isinstance(checkpoint_id, str) or not checkpoint_id: return None return thread_id, str(checkpoint_ns or ""), checkpoint_id def _checkpoint_identity(checkpoint_tuple: Any) -> tuple[str, str, str] | None: return _config_identity(getattr(checkpoint_tuple, "config", {}) or {}) def _checkpoint_exists(checkpoint_tuple: Any) -> bool: """Distinguish a persisted empty checkpoint from an accessor miss. LangGraph represents a missing explicit ``checkpoint_id`` as an empty snapshot that echoes the requested config. Persisted snapshots always carry metadata, a creation timestamp, or a raw checkpoint payload. """ explicit = getattr(checkpoint_tuple, "checkpoint_exists", None) if isinstance(explicit, bool): return explicit if getattr(checkpoint_tuple, "metadata", None) is not None: return True if getattr(checkpoint_tuple, "created_at", None) is not None: return True return isinstance(getattr(checkpoint_tuple, "checkpoint", None), dict) async def find_checkpoint_before_message( accessor: Any, head_checkpoint: Any, message_id: str, *, max_depth: int, ) -> Any: """Walk one parent lineage and return the first checkpoint before ``message_id``. Following ``parent_config`` is important after a regenerate: a thread can contain sibling checkpoint branches, and a global time-ordered scan can otherwise select a checkpoint from the wrong branch. Duration-only metadata checkpoints do not represent an addressable conversation state and are skipped. """ if message_id not in {_message_id(message) for message in checkpoint_messages(head_checkpoint)}: raise CheckpointLineageIntegrityError("Target message is not present in the checkpoint head") current = head_checkpoint visited: set[tuple[str, str, str]] = set() current_identity = _checkpoint_identity(current) if current_identity is not None: visited.add(current_identity) # Each step performs one ancestor read, but normal branch/regenerate # histories cross the target boundary within 1–3 reads. Keep max_depth as # a conservative safety cap for valid histories with many intermediate or # duration-only checkpoints. for _ in range(max_depth): parent_config = getattr(current, "parent_config", None) if not isinstance(parent_config, dict): raise CheckpointParentMissingError("Checkpoint lineage ended before the target message") parent = await accessor.aget(parent_config) parent_identity = _checkpoint_identity(parent) requested_parent_identity = _config_identity(parent_config) if parent_identity is None or not _checkpoint_exists(parent) or (requested_parent_identity is not None and parent_identity != requested_parent_identity): raise CheckpointLineageIntegrityError("Checkpoint parent link is not addressable") if parent_identity is not None: if parent_identity in visited: raise CheckpointLineageIntegrityError("Checkpoint lineage contains a cycle") visited.add(parent_identity) if is_duration_only_checkpoint(parent): current = parent continue parent_message_ids = {_message_id(message) for message in checkpoint_messages(parent)} if message_id not in parent_message_ids: return parent current = parent raise CheckpointLineageIntegrityError(f"Checkpoint lineage exceeded the scan limit ({max_depth})") def find_checkpoint_before_message_chronologically( checkpoints: Sequence[Any], message_id: str, ) -> tuple[Any | None, bool]: """Return ``(replay_base, target_found)`` from newest-first history. This is a compatibility fallback for imported or legacy checkpoints that do not carry ``parent_config`` links. Callers must prefer the lineage walk when links are available because a chronological scan cannot distinguish sibling checkpoint branches. Duration-only checkpoints are ignored, and only checkpoints with an addressable id can become the replay base. """ previous_checkpoint = None for checkpoint_tuple in reversed(checkpoints): if is_duration_only_checkpoint(checkpoint_tuple): continue message_ids = {_message_id(message) for message in checkpoint_messages(checkpoint_tuple)} if message_id in message_ids: return previous_checkpoint, True if checkpoint_configurable(checkpoint_tuple).get("checkpoint_id"): previous_checkpoint = checkpoint_tuple return None, False
